Um, never thought of that!  Never actually knew, Lazarus takes into
account the locale when it starts up.  Just tested it, which also
means *.af-za.po as it is now, is totally useless (even though it
conforms to Lazarus file naming standards) as the locale under Linux
is set to af_ZA.UTF-8 (type "export $LANG" from the command line)
which means it will never match the non-standard *.af-za.po extension.
Just tested this.

Either the mapping algorithm: LANG -> filename or the filename can be fixed. It has not yet been decided.


What does Windows do?  Can Windows be changed to Afrikaans?

I don't know. On windows GetLocaleInfo(... , LOCALE_SABBREVLANGNAME, ... and
GetLocaleInfo( ... , LOCALE_SABBREVCTRYNAME are used. Maybe you can tweak your windows settings so that they return AF and ZAF or something like that.
